Tadek Ocean Engineering is supporting Spanish tidal energy developer Magallanes Renovables on its installation of a floating tidal array in the UK.
Tadek will support Magallanes with detailed design involving cables, installation and mooring systems.
Magallanes secured two contracts in CfD allocation rounds in the UK.
At the Morlais Demonstration Zone, in North Wales, the company will install two 1.5MW tidal energy platforms, adding 3MW to the 6MW secured in 2022.
Established in 2010, Tadek delivers specialist consultancy, complex analysis, engineering solutions and practical project delivery for marine, offshore and subsea projects.
It has worked on 200-plus projects worldwide.
